We went to Teneriffe Falls formerly known as Kamikaze Falls. Its a  6 miles round trip moderate hike. It would have been an easy hike if not for the new unfinished part of hike at the end. Its as rocky as it can be :)
The first 2 miles of hike is well paved and is an easy walk.
First Leg of HIke (Pic courtesy Dhaval Shah)
Its the second leg of hike the last 1 mile which is tough. It says 1 mile from the intersection marked "Teneriffe Falls" but it sure feels more..;).. Bring along your hiking boots for this last leg or you'll sure feel each n every rock/stone on way..:)

 The views of valley below are beautiful so is the fall.
